Deluxe Entertainment Services Group Inc. is a global leader in digital media and entertainment services across film, video and online content from capture to consumption.

Since 1915, Deluxe has been the trusted partner for the world's most successful Hollywood studios, independent film companies, TV networks, exhibitors, advertisers and others, offering best-in-class solutions in production, post production, distribution, asset and workflow management and new digital
solution-based technologies.

With operations in Los Angeles, New York and around the globe, the company employs nearly 7,000 of the most talented, highly honored and recognized artists and industry veterans worldwide. For more information visit www.bydeluxe.com.

We currently have an opening for an Audio Description Account Coordinator/QC Technician - Brazilian Portuguese. This position is located in Burbank, CA.

Primary Responsibilities

• Coordinate materials, translators for Brazilian Portuguese AD projects—broadcast and theatrical.
• Maintain up-to-date scheduling / coordination on database.
• Some client interaction is required, primarily via email
• Prepare and send internal communications to critical departments regarding project specs, revisions, and approvals.
• Schedule 3rd party vendors as needed.
• Individual will at times perform quality assurance testing on audio description tracks against video for Brazilian Portuguese-language AD files.
• Functions as a backup to other coordinators when necessary
• Other duties as assigned.
• Assist Project Managers with billing packets as needed.
• Other duties as assigned. 

Qualifications

The ideal candidate will possess the following knowledge, experience, and skill-set:

• BA or BS degree preferred. 
• 1-2 years post-production or account coordinator experience preferred, but entry-level candidates will be considered. 
• Must have strong interpersonal skills.
• Must be highly organized and able to work in a fast-paced, small-team environment. 
• Individual must also be able to work independently within their own process. 
• Ability to apply common sense understanding to carry out instructions furnished in written, verbal, or diagram form. 
• Proficiency with Microsoft Office, inventory, internet, order processing, and database software. 
• Solid technical understanding of the feature film and/or television post-production environment a plus.
• Flexibility to work extended hours and/or weekends to meet project deadlines.
• 2-4 years quality control experience in entertainment, gaming or related field preferred.
